About Symbols of Celebration: Festive Serveware

Because these pieces feature high-quality enamel and gold electroplating, they require a gentle touch. Clean them with a soft, dry cloth rather than harsh detergents to maintain their sheen. Whether you use the Aakar tray for dry fruits or the Bindu plate for mithai, keep in mind the finish is delicate and meant to hold food, not handle a dishwasher.
